Demolition Is First Step to Creation The United Illuminating Company took its first steps toward development in Orange with the demolition of the former National Amusements Showcase Cinemas at 100 Marsh Hill Road, Orange. The United Illuminating Company Green Demolition initiative will enable the company to receive Leadership in Energy & Environmental Design (LEED) certification for the new Operations Center proposed for the site. The demolition process separates all of the components of a building including concrete, carpeting, gypsum and steel and re-uses these materials in new building development.
Demolition is expected to be completed by May 25, 2009. Construction of the proposed 230,000 square foot Operations Center is expected to be completed by Mid-2012.
